Industry Dynamics and User Expectations

The past decade has seen exponential growth in mobile gaming, with revenues surpassing $100 billion globally in 2023 (Newzoo, 2023). Consumers not only expect high-quality graphics and engaging gameplay but also demand instantaneous responses and uninterrupted sessions. Native applications historically delivered these standards due to direct access to device hardware and optimized performance frameworks. However, the proliferation of Progressive Web Apps (PWAs) and advanced JavaScript engines has narrowed this performance disparity.

Technical Foundations Enabling Native-like Web Gaming

Several technological advances underpin the feasibility of high-fidelity web gaming:

  • WebAssembly: Compiles code near-native speed, enabling complex game logic and physics calculations to run efficiently within browsers.
  • WebGL and WebGPU: Allow hardware-accelerated graphics rendering comparable to native APIs, particularly for 3D environments.
  • Service Workers and Push API: Support offline capabilities and push notifications, essential for maintaining user engagement.
  • Progressive Web Apps (PWAs): Facilitate installability, full-screen mode, and home screen access, blurring the lines between web and native app experiences.

Strategic Implications for Mobile Game Developers

Adopting web-based architectures with native-like performance means gaming brands can realize several strategic benefits:

  1. Broader Accessibility: Instant access across devices via URLs reduces barrier to entry and simplifies user onboarding.
  2. Lower Development Costs: Single codebase deployment minimizes resource duplication across platforms.
  3. Enhanced User Engagement: Features like offline gameplay, real-time updates, and push notifications optimize retention.
